At 10:46 PM 3/8/97 -0500, andrew stellman wrote:
>as for early 3-d displays, i know that when my father was a chemistry grad student in the sixties (sorry, don't know the year offhand), he worked with an extremely clever 3-d system for displaying and rotating molecules that worked with the LDS-1 line-drawing graphics system.

I checked with a friend at Evans & Sutherland who remembers the LDS-1 coming out between 1969 and 1971.
